Output 63145bc010e0c86dc4e3fa1eeca7c0bf779c7d7ef11b966905f8f8ccd4754c86:1

value
3113920
script pubkey
OP_0 OP_PUSHBYTES_20 3e8b914bf177b76e77d1994a645aa37634fd7584
address
ltc1q869ezjl3w7mkua73n99xgk4rwc606avycrgk6d
transaction
63145bc010e0c86dc4e3fa1eeca7c0bf779c7d7ef11b966905f8f8ccd4754c86
spent
true